NEW ORLEANS — UCF won its third game in a row Saturday 38-31 over Tulane in a showdown for first place in the American Athletic Conference. The No. 22 Knights were led by quarterback John Rhys Plumlee who earned the start over Mikey Keene against the No. 17 Green Wave.
